Kristina Chopa is a Master’s student in International Affairs at the Hertie School of Governance in Berlin and Global Affairs in Munk School, UofT. With a background in documentary filmmaking and NGO work, she explores how narratives, memory, and media shape public understanding of international conflicts. 

Originally from Ukraine, Kristina’s research and creative work center on the intersections of war, identity, and collective responsibility. Since October 2025, she has been a research assistant for Professor Snyder.
